Where does “pagawe” come from?
pagawe (Makasar) comes from Makasar pa-, from Proto-Malayo-Polynesian pa-, from Proto-Austronesian pa- — causative prefix.
pagawe (Makasar): to use; to utilize; to make something function well of tools or machines
